X-Git-Url: https://git.mdrn.pl/edumed.git/blobdiff_plain/18ecb6c6e58f9b273636f80f485e749a97ebdf60..cd7d2e5171bebc3b447f24878cb8f56caefe1e58:/wtem/views.py?ds=sidebyside diff --git a/wtem/views.py b/wtem/views.py index d786846..be78eb5 100644 --- a/wtem/views.py +++ b/wtem/views.py @@ -46,6 +46,8 @@ def form(request, submission_id, key): state = CompetitionState.get_state() if state == CompetitionState.DURING: state = 'single' + if request.META['REMOTE_ADDR'] in getattr(settings, 'WTEM_CONTEST_IP_ALLOW', []): + state = 'single' return globals()['form_' + state](request, submission_id, key)